About PENZANCE-MADRON SCOUT GROUP
PENZANCE-MADRON SCOUT GROUP is a registered charity in England and Wales (registration number 300733). Based on official Charity Commission data, it holds a "Good Standing" rating with a CharityScore of 60/100 — a charity in good standing with solid but not exceptional governance indicators. This reflects adequate performance across most criteria, though some areas fall short of the strongest-rated charities. In its most recent reporting year (2025), PENZANCE-MADRON SCOUT GROUP reported a total income of £10,114 and total expenditure of £16,946, a spending ratio of 168% indicating a strong proportion of funds directed to charitable work.
